Corrugated roof repair services focus on restoring the integrity and functionality of roofs made from corrugated metal panels. These services typically involve inspecting the roof for damage, replacing or repairing bent, cracked, or corroded panels, and sealing any leaks or gaps to prevent water intrusion. Skilled contractors assess the extent of the damage and use appropriate materials to ensure the roof maintains its protective qualities. Proper repair work helps extend the lifespan of corrugated roofing systems and maintains their performance against weather elements.
Corrugated roof repair addresses common problems such as rust, corrosion, punctures, and panel warping. Over time, exposure to moisture and environmental factors can weaken the metal, leading to leaks and structural issues. Repair services help eliminate leaks that could cause water damage to underlying structures and prevent further deterioration of the roofing material. Additionally, addressing issues early can avoid more costly repairs or the need for complete roof replacement in the future.
This type of roofing repair is often utilized by commercial properties, agricultural buildings, industrial facilities, and some residential properties with metal roofing. Warehouses, barns, workshops, and storage facilities frequently feature corrugated metal roofs due to their durability and cost-effectiveness. The overview below groups typical Corrugated Roof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Cambridge, VT.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Material Replacement - Replacing damaged corrugated roofing panels typically costs between $1,200 and $3,500, depending on panel size and material type. For example, a small repair may be around $1,200, while larger projects could reach $3,500 or more.
Leak Repair - Fixing leaks in corrugated roofs generally ranges from $300 to $1,000. Minor leaks might cost closer to $300, whereas extensive leak repairs could be around $1,000 or higher.
Sealant Application - Applying sealants to corrugated roofs usually falls within the $200 to $600 range. The cost varies based on roof size and the number of areas needing sealing.
Inspection and Consultation - Professional inspections typically cost between $100 and $300. This fee may be applied toward repair costs if work is commissioned through a local service provider.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
